About Seli

Seli is a rural settlement in Berinag,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and. It has a population of 166 in about 43 households (avg size: 3.86). Approximate literacy: 62.65%.

Population of Seli

Population (Total)166
Male81
Female85
Children (0–6 years)22
Households43
Literate persons104
Illiterate persons62
Total workers84
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1049
Literacy (approx.)62.65%
SC population25
ST population0
